Russian assault leaves 50 settlements in Vinnytsia Oblast and 50,000 folks in Odesa Oblast with out energy

A big-scale Russian assault on power amenities has left 50 settlements in Vinnytsia Oblast and 50,000 folks in Odesa Oblast with out energy.

Supply: press providers for Vinnytsia Oblast Navy Administration and Odesa Oblast Navy Administration

Particulars: In Vinnytsia Oblast, the Russians hit a important infrastructure facility. On account of the assault, 50 settlements had been left with out energy. No studies of individuals injured have been acquired.

Russian forces additionally attacked the power sector within the south of Odesa Oblast. On account of the assault, greater than 50,000 residents had been quickly left with out electrical energy. Three residential buildings, warehouse and workplace premises and vehicles had been broken.

There have been no casualties after the assault and demanding infrastructure is working on turbines.
